NORTH LIBERTY, Iowa, March 01, 2016 -- Heartland Express, Inc. (Nasdaq:HTLD) announced that on Tuesday, March 8, 2016, Michael Gerdin, Chief Executive Officer and Chris Strain, Controller will present at the Raymond James & Associates 37th Annual Institutional Investors Conference at 7:05 am (central time).
Interested investors can access a live audio webcast of the Heartland Express, Inc. presentation at the Raymond James & Associates 37th Annual Institutional Investors Conference at http://wsw.com/webcast/rj99/htld.
Heartland Express is an irregular route truckload carrier based in North Liberty, Iowa serving customers with shipping lanes throughout the United States. Heartland focuses on medium to short haul regional freight, offering shippers industry leading on-time service so they can achieve their strategic goals for their customers.
